Water line replacement services involve removing and replacing aging or damaged water supply pipes within a property. This process typically includes disconnecting the existing water lines, installing new piping, and ensuring proper connections to the main water supply and fixtures. The goal is to restore reliable water flow and prevent leaks or interruptions caused by deteriorating pipes. Professionals who offer water line replacement assess the condition of existing plumbing to determine the most effective approach, whether it involves partial or complete replacement.

These services address common issues such as frequent leaks, low water pressure, discolored water, or pipe corrosion. Over time, pipes can become worn, cracked, or clogged, leading to water damage or higher utility bills. Replacing old or compromised lines helps prevent costly repairs and minimizes the risk of water-related property damage. By upgrading outdated plumbing, property owners can improve water quality and ensure consistent, safe water delivery throughout the building.

Water line replacement services are frequently utilized in residential properties, including single-family homes, townhouses, and condominiums. They are also common in commercial buildings and multi-unit complexes where aging infrastructure may cause operational issues. Older properties, especially those with galvanized pipes or outdated plumbing systems, often benefit from this service to modernize their water supply and avoid potential failures. Additionally, properties undergoing renovations or expansions might require water line upgrades to accommodate increased demand or new fixtures.

Cost Range for Water Line Replacement - The typical cost for replacing a water line can vary widely, often between $1,500 and $4,500 depending on factors like pipe length and accessibility. For example, replacing a standard residential water line may cost around $2,500 in Forsyth County, GA. Local pros can provide estimates tailored to specific property needs.

Factors Influencing Replacement Costs - Costs are influenced by the length of the water line, pipe material, and whether the work involves trenching or surface repairs. On average, a standard replacement may fall within the $1,500 to $3,500 range, but complex jobs can reach higher amounts. Contact local service providers for detailed quotes.

Average Cost for Material and Labor - Material costs for water lines typically range from $0.50 to $2.00 per foot, with labor costs adding to the overall expense. For a typical 50-foot replacement, total expenses often hover around $2,000 to $4,000, depending on specific conditions. Local contractors can assess site-specific factors for precise pricing.

Additional Expenses to Consider - Additional costs may include permits, surface repairs, or dealing with existing underground utilities, which can add several hundred dollars to the total. Overall, the complete water line replacement project in Forsyth County might range from $1,500 to over $5,000 depending on scope. Local service providers can help determine accurate estimates based on individual circumstances.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When should water line replacement be considered? Water line replacement may be needed if there are persistent leaks, low water pressure, or frequent pipe bursts in the property.

How long does a typical water line replacement take? The duration of water line replacement varies based on the property's size and the extent of the work but is generally completed within a day or two.

What are common signs indicating water line issues? Signs include unexplained increases in water bills, discolored or foul-smelling water, and visible leaks or water pooling around the foundation.

Are water line replacements disruptive to daily routines? Some disruption may occur, especially if underground work is involved, but experienced service providers aim to minimize inconvenience.
